How To Maintain Healthy Hair Naturally With Traditional Herbs

From historic times, our ancestors have used many types of herbs to cleanse, condition, and treat the scalp and hair. In traditional Chinese medicine, herbs like ginseng and He Shou Wu (polygonum multiflora) are well-known for helping to stop hair loss and prevent gray hair.

      Fenugreek is used in ancient Egypt to aid in hair growth and help it add shine. Rosemary and lavender are used in Rome for their antiseptic properties, and they are used to soothe the scalp. Research has found that fenugreek can make hair thicker and lessen hair loss by making hair roots stronger. Likewise, rosemary oil has been proven to boost hair growth as effectively as minoxidil, a well-known hair growth product, which is why it's popular in treatments for hair loss.

      Ayurveda, an old Indian system of health, has a long history of using herbs for hair care. Herbs like Amla, Brahmi, and Bhringraj are key in Ayurvedic hair care, known for making hair stronger, keeping the scalp healthy, and helping hair grow. When it comes to India, the popular herb is Amla or Indian gooseberry. It is high in vitamin C and antioxidants. It helps in promoting hair growth, strengthens hair follicles, adds volume, and takes care of scalp. It helps stop hair from turning gray too soon and works as a natural conditioner to make hair smooth and shiny.     

          Bhringraj, called the 'king of herbs' for hair care, is a key part of traditional Indian hair treatments. It is known for refreshing the hair and scalp, improving blood flow, and promoting hair growth.

          Shikakai is very helpful in maintaining natural oils in scalp and is often used as an alternative to shampoo. It acts as a natural detangler with deep cleansing action which can help combat dust and remove it without causing any irritation. Neem with its anti-fungal and anti-bacterial properties can help fight lice and dandruff, maintaining a healthy scalp.

What Are Essential Herbs To Manage Healthy Hair?

Nature really has a treasure of essential herbs that can keep hair healthy. Herbs such as lavender, rosemary, and sage do more than just smell nice; they are great for the hair. They help activate hair roots, promote growth, and make scalp healthier. Lavender oil is well-known not only for its soothing scent but also for preventing itchy scalp and dandruff. Rosemary oil is also fantastic as it helps make hair thicker and grow faster by boosting cell growth. Sage, which has been used since prehistoric times is very beneficial in cleansing the scalp and promotes hair color and intensity and also prevents dandruff. These herbs are very gentle on skin and helps prevent many hair and scalp issues. They show that what's good for nature is also good for us.

What Is The Science Behind Herbal Hair Care?

Herbs interact with the biological mechanisms of scalp and hair. Herbs such as nettle and burdock root have active ingredients that provide important nutrients to the scalp, improve blood flow, and clean out the skin, all of which are important for keeping hair roots healthy. For instance, silica in horsetail makes hair stronger, and saponins in soapwort help clean the hair naturally without removing its natural oils. Research has proven that using these herbs regularly can lead to better hair growth, stronger hair, and healthier scalp.

DIY Hair Care Treatments

Herbal hair care treatments passed down from generations have proved very efficient in fighting the scalp and hair issues. For example, a mix made from apple cider vinegar by incorporating sage and rosemary can help balance pH of the scalp and gives hair a long-lasting shine. Another DIY hair care treatment involves a mask of amla powder and yogurt which deeply conditions hair promoting hair growth. These recipes help people tailor their hair care by changing the amounts of each ingredient to match their unique hair type and needs. This customized method is fun and works well to keep hair healthy and beautiful.
